Understanding Property Management Fees 

It’s vital to acknowledge that property management fees can vary considerably depending on the location and the company. The national average range for property management services typically falls between 5-12% of the monthly rent collected. Nevertheless, it’s prudent to assess the services provided by each company before basing your decision solely on cost. By doing this, you can ascertain the best value for your investment. 

Many property managers utilize the fees they charge to encompass a range of services including marketing and advertising for new tenants, rent collection, tenant screening and background checks, addressing tenant inquiries and requests, managing maintenance and repairs, performing regular inspections, preparing legal documents such as leases and violation notices, and offering administrative support

However, these services may not be included in the fees charged by every property management company. Therefore, it’s important to read the fine print and ask questions before hiring a property management company. 

Exploring Additional Charges 

When evaluating the expenses involved in hiring a property management company, it’s important to remember that they may apply either a fixed charge or a fee determined by a percentage of the rent collected. Moreover, they may levy additional fees for specific services. For example: 

  • Leasing and Tenant Placement Fees: This fee is typically a one-time charge equivalent to one month’s rent. This charge involves marketing your property, screening tenants, and negotiating leases. 
  • Maintenance Fees: These fees can include a variety of tasks, from fixing a leaky faucet to replacing a roof. It’s a good idea to ask your property management company how they calculate maintenance fees and if there’s a limit on the charge for repairs. 
  • Tenant Late Payment Fees: Property management companies may apply late payment fees if tenants do not pay their rent on time. Late fees usually amount to a percentage of the rent and vary among different companies. 
  • Advertising Fees: This charge includes photography for listings, internet advertising space, and print materials. Advertising fees are occasionally charged along with other expenses, so it’s crucial to ask about this before finalizing any contracts.
